首页 > TAG信息列表 > OffsetX

IOS开发之——事件处理-抽屉效果(70),Android核心知识点

[self.view addSubview:mainView]; _mainView=mainView; } 3.2 滑动视图处理 -(void)touchesMoved:(NSSet<UITouch *> *)touches withEvent:(UIEvent *)event { //获取UITouch对象 UITouch *touch=[touches anyObject]; //获取当前点 CGPoint currentPoint=[touch locationIn

事件坐标:screenX,clientX,pageX,offsetX的区别

e.screenX/e.screenY: 事件发生时鼠标相对于电脑屏幕的坐标。e.screenX,e.screenY的最大值不会超过屏幕分辨率。 e.clientX/e.clientY: 事件发生时鼠标在浏览器内容区域的坐标。 浏览器内容区域就是浏览器窗口中用来显示网页的可视区域,不包括滚动条和工具栏,也不随滚动条的移动而

event兼容,clientX,pageX,offsetX和screenX的区别,图片移动

3.event兼容,clientX,pageX,offsetX和screenX的区别,图片移动。例 3.1:event兼容,clientX,offsetX和screenX的区别,图片移动。clientX 设置或获取鼠标指针位置相对于窗口客户区域的 x 坐标,其中客户区域不包括窗口自身的控件和滚动条。pageX:参照点也是浏览器内容区域的左上角,但它包括

offsetX各种值总结

pageX: 页面X坐标位置 pageY: 页面Y坐标位置 screenX: 屏幕X坐标位置 screenY: 屏幕Y坐标位置 clientX: 鼠标的坐标到页面左侧的距离 clientY: 鼠标的坐标到页面顶部的距离 clientWidth:可视区域的宽度 clientHeight:可视区域的高度 offsetX:鼠标坐标到元素的左侧的距离 offsetY:鼠

Vue 滑块解锁组件(无UA算法校验)

依据 JS拖动滑块验证 开发的 Vue 滑块解锁组件。 <template> <div ref="wrap" class="slider-unlock"> <div class="before">请按住滑块,拖动到最右边</div> <div ref="after" class="after"> <div cl

e.pageX,e.offsetX,e.clientX的区别

e.pageX,e.offsetX,e.clientX区别e.pageX,e.offsetX,e.clientX区别e.pageX,e.offsetX,e.clientX区别e.pageX,e.offsetX,e.clientX区别e.pageX,e.offsetX,e.clientX区别e.pageX,e.offsetX,e.clientX区别e.pageX,e.offsetX,e.clientX区别 <!DOCTYPE html> <html> <head>

TCAX 时间计算及文字定位(英文+谷歌机翻中文)

Introduction To a subtitle effect, the positioning and timing are the most two fundamental yet important aspects. The basic function of TCAX is to provide the required information for the user to deal with these two problems. Time Calculation The basic t

报表开发人员手册:自定义报表组件编写

FastReport vcl是用于 Delphi、C++ Builder、RAD Studio 和 Lazarus 的报告和文档创建 VCL 库。它提供了可视化模板设计器,可以访问 30 多种格式,并可以部署到云、网站、电子邮件和打印中。 FastReport 有大量的组件,可以放在报表设计页面上。它们是:文本、图片、线条、几何图形、OLE

图解Js event对象offsetX, clientX, pageX, screenX, layerX, x区别

转载自:https://blog.csdn.net/lzding/article/details/45437707 一:兼容性       二:图解 event.offsetX,event.clientX,event.pageX,event.screenX属性     三:图解 event.layerX,event.layerY 属性     四:图解 event.x,event.y 属性  

前端大佬带你玩转超简易图片放大镜

今天会介绍一个在商城网站经常看到的功能,图片放大镜的效果:我们试试用最少的 JavaScript,尽量使用 CSS 以及最简单的 HTML 结构去实现,那我们就开始啦。如果不会没关系可以找我拿相关资料教程 点击 这里即可领取资料,让我们一起学习吧HTML 的部份 打开 CodePen 编辑器,在 HTML 的部份加

随机控制泡泡和分支流程控制

随机控制泡泡和分支流程控制 1 随机数 1.1 随机数生成器 Java通过算法实现一个随机数生成器。 1.2 Math.random() Math.random()返回值是一个0到1之间的随机数,其范围包括0不包括1。 如果需要生成[min,max]随机数使用如下公式即可: int r=(int)(Math.random()*(max-min))+min; 案例

WebGIS中地图瓦片在Canvas上的拼接显示原理【系列1-3】

1.前言 在之前的五个章节中,我们在第一章节里介绍了WebGIS的基本框架和技术,第二章节里介绍了什么是瓦片行列号以及计算它的原因,第三章节里介绍了如何通过地理范围计算出这个范围内瓦片的行列号,第四和第五章节里介绍了在得到瓦片行列号后如何获得离线和在线地图的URL,这个章节里,我们

正弦余弦定理,求圆弧度或度数

由于最近玩机器人,所以总涉及到一些导航地图数据的处理,需要发任务,添加导航点,发送自由导航信息,少不了与canvas打交道了。 首先我们好弄清楚是什么正弦余弦定理,什么是勾股定理,角度和弧度的换算,其实我也差不多忘光光了~~ 忘掉不丢人,百度走起~~,哈哈哈。。。。 下图就是点击拖动出来的

--《捡芝麻》-关于pageX、offsetX、clientX分别是什么--

offsetX、offsetY与pageX、pageY offsetX、offsetY是触发事件时,鼠标坐标,与事件对象的坐标的偏移量 pageX、pageY是事件触发时,鼠标位置相对于页面左上角的坐标 clientX、clientY是事件触发时,鼠标与浏览器窗口的左上角的相对坐标

js实现拖拽效果

代码如下 <html> <head> <style> div { width: 100px; height: 100px; background: pink; position: relative; top: 10px; left: 10px; } </style> </head><body><div>m

js实现拖拽效果

<html> <head> <style> div { width: 100px; height: 100px; background: pink; position: relative; top: 10px; left: 10px; } </style> </head> <body> <

offsetX/Y、clientX/Y、pageX/Y、screenX/Y

offsetX、offsetY:鼠标相对于事件源元素(srcElement)的X、Y坐标 clientX、clientY: 鼠标相对于浏览器窗口可视区域的X,Y坐标(窗口坐标),可视区域不包括工具栏和滚动条。 pageX、pagey: 类似于event.clientX、event.clientY,但它们使用的是文档坐标而非窗口坐标。这2个属性不是标准属性

仿抖音右滑清屏,左滑列表功能

概述 ​ 项目中要实现仿抖音直播间滑动清屏,侧滑列表的功能,在此记录下实现过程和踩坑记录希望避免大家走些弯路,也当作自己的一个总结 ​ 首先看下Demo中的效果   ​ 阅读文章需要提前熟悉些事件分发的内容,相信大家都已经了解过了,网上也有很多优秀的文章,这里推荐两篇自己读过印

js拖拽效果的原理及多种实现方法

<script> // 第一种方法实现 var div = document.querySelector("div"); // 给元素身上加上鼠标按下的事件,并将鼠标事件e参数传递进去 div.onmousedown = function(e){ // 这里要注意的是,给文档对象身上加鼠标移动事件

flutter自定义floatingActionButton的位置

class CustomFloatingActionButtonLocation extends FloatingActionButtonLocation { FloatingActionButtonLocation location; double offsetX; // X方向的偏移量 double offsetY; // Y方向的偏移量 CustomFloatingActionButtonLocation(this.location, this

(day05—06)获得鼠标的坐标

<!doctype html> <html> <head> <meta charset="UTF-8"> <title>在当前显示区范围内实现点不到的小方块</title> <style> div{position:fixed;width:100px;height:100px; background-image:url(images/xiaoxin.gif); backgr

jquery-ui拖拽对齐线位置不对的操作

1,在draggable的drag中直接获取$(this).offset()来给对齐线设置top和left; 2,在draggable的drag中直接获取event的clientX去和event的offsetX去做减,此时的offsetX有可能在拖动过程中发生变化,      造成位置不准确的情况。 需要在start钩子中缓存下开始时候的鼠标位置,然后在拖动过程